Harley Davidson Historical Dividend Yield Growth
A solid dividend growth pattern of Harley Davidson could indicate future dividend growth is likely, which can signal long-term profitability for Harley Davidson. When investors calculate the dividend yield growth rate, they can use any interval of time they wish. They may also calculate the dividend yield growth rate using the least-squares method or simply take an annualized figure over a given time period. Dividend Yield is Harley Davidson dividend as a percentage of Harley Davidson stock price. Harley Davidson dividend yield is a measure of Harley Davidson stock productivity, which can be interpreted as interest rate earned on an Harley Davidson investment.
